What is an LDPE Foam Sheet?
An LDPE Foam Sheet is manufactured from Low-Density Polyethylene (LDPE) using a closed-cell foam structure. It is soft, flexible, lightweight, chemically stable, and resistant to moisture, making it ideal for expansion joints and protective applications.
Its closed-cell construction prevents water absorption while allowing the material to compress and recover, accommodating movement caused by thermal expansion and contraction.
Why is an LDPE Foam Sheet Required?
Concrete naturally expands and contracts due to temperature changes and shrinkage. Without an expansion joint filler, slabs and structures can develop cracks and surface damage.

How Does an LDPE Foam Sheet Work?
Step 1 – Placement
The foam sheet is installed within expansion joints before concrete placement or between structural elements.
Step 2 – Concrete Movement
As concrete expands or contracts, the foam compresses without damaging adjacent slabs.
Step 3 – Recovery
The foam regains its original shape after movement, maintaining the integrity of the joint.
Step 4 – Protection
The closed-cell structure blocks moisture penetration and protects the joint from deterioration.

Types of LDPE Foam Sheets
Expansion Joint Foam Sheet
Designed specifically for concrete expansion joints.
Packaging Grade LDPE Foam
Used for product protection during storage and transportation.
Flooring Underlay Foam
Installed beneath laminate, wooden, and engineered flooring systems.
Insulation Grade LDPE Foam
Used for HVAC ducts, piping, and thermal insulation applications.
Custom-Cut LDPE Foam Sheets
Available in various sizes and thicknesses to meet project-specific requirements.

Frequently Asked Questions
What is an LDPE Foam Sheet?
An LDPE Foam Sheet is a closed-cell polyethylene foam used for expansion joints, insulation, cushioning, and moisture protection in construction and industrial applications.
Why is an LDPE Foam Sheet used in concrete expansion joints?
It accommodates concrete expansion and contraction, reducing stress and preventing cracks while acting as a moisture barrier.
Is an LDPE Foam Sheet waterproof?
Yes. The closed-cell structure provides excellent resistance to water absorption and moisture penetration.
Can LDPE Foam Sheets be used for insulation?
Yes. They provide effective thermal and sound insulation for buildings, HVAC systems, and industrial applications.
Where are LDPE Foam Sheets commonly used?
They are used in concrete expansion joints, industrial flooring, highways, bridges, airports, warehouses, packaging, flooring underlays, HVAC systems, and precast concrete structures.
